Service from manager and colleague, was good and a nice atmosphere, food was overall poor - pork burnt end were just fat, grease and syrup - really unpleasant , mackerel was great, fish tacos a bit too salty. Main of £130 porterhouse ordered medium and well rested but was undercooked, tough with raw fat, likely from steak not being at room temperature when cooking, grill too hot and not rested long enough, the side of hispi cabbage was inedible as not cooked with core left in and the new season Jersey Royals were clearly cooked earlier in the day and not warmed up. We were comp?d 2 starters after complaining that the toilets were filthy (out or order noticed added shortly after), we were also offered the chance to talk to the chef when leaving which we declined as saw no benefit - we?d spent £226 on 2 courses with wine and service. And whilst it is a bit of theatre, please stop putting hot charcoal on to each course, removing it and leaving nasty gritty bits on everything. Evening held so much promise but despite attentive staff, food was poor. We still paid our 13.5% service charge as not servers fault. It was also amusing to hear the sustainability message surrounded by plastic plants hanging from the beamed ceiling and seeing all the apples and varieties of plums going to waste in the orchards.
